A Brief History of Russian Military Uniforms

Russia's military uniforms have a long and storied history, dating back to the 18th century when the country's military forces were still in their formative stages. Over the years, the design and materials used in Russian military uniforms have undergone significant changes, reflecting the country's evolving military strategies, technological advancements, and cultural influences. Here are some key milestones in the development of Russian military uniforms:

* **18th century**: Russian military uniforms were characterized by their bright colors and ornate embroidery, reflecting the country's imperial ambitions and cultural traditions. Soldiers wore elaborate uniforms with gold braid, lace, and other decorative elements.

* **19th century**: As the Russian Empire expanded, its military uniforms became more functional and practical. Uniforms were made of cotton and wool, with a focus on comfort and durability.

* **Soviet era**: During the Soviet period, Russian military uniforms became more austere and functional, reflecting the country's emphasis on utility and practicality. Uniforms were made of durable cotton and wool, with a focus on simplicity and ease of maintenance.

The Soviet-Era Uniform: A Reflection of Communist Ideology

The Soviet-era uniform was a reflection of the communist ideology that dominated Russia during that period. The uniforms were characterized by their simplicity, functionality, and egalitarianism. Soldiers wore identical uniforms with minimal insignia or decorations, emphasizing the idea of equality and solidarity among comrades.

**Key Features of the Soviet-Era Uniform:**

* **Simplistic design**: The Soviet-era uniform was designed to be functional and practical, with a focus on comfort and durability.

* **Egalitarianism**: Soldiers wore identical uniforms with minimal insignia or decorations, emphasizing the idea of equality and solidarity among comrades.

* **Limited use of colors**: Uniforms were generally worn in muted colors, such as green, brown, and beige, reflecting the Soviet emphasis on utility and practicality.
